Michael Kors, a globally recognized name in luxury fashion and accessories, has embraced the convenience of buy-now-pay-later (BNPL) services, specifically partnering with Afterpay. This allows customers to spread the cost of their purchases into four interest-free installments. While the online experience is well-documented, understanding how Afterpay works in Michael Kors' physical stores requires a more detailed look. This article will delve into the ins and outs of using Afterpay at Michael Kors in-store, covering everything from the initial purchase to returns, refunds, and gift card usage.

Afterpay Michael Kors: In-Store Convenience and Flexibility

The integration of Afterpay into Michael Kors' brick-and-mortar stores provides a significant advantage for consumers. It removes the financial barrier for many who might otherwise hesitate to purchase higher-priced items. Instead of needing to pay the full amount upfront, customers can spread the cost over four fortnightly payments. This allows for better budgeting and the opportunity to acquire coveted items without immediate financial strain.

The in-store process is generally straightforward. When making a purchase at a participating Michael Kors store, simply inform the sales associate that you wish to use Afterpay. They will guide you through the process, which typically involves scanning a QR code with your Afterpay app or providing your phone number for verification. Once verified, the purchase is processed, and the first payment is automatically deducted from your linked bank account or debit card. The remaining payments are then automatically scheduled for the following weeks.

Understanding the Afterpay Payment Schedule

It's crucial to understand the payment schedule to avoid late fees. The first payment is usually due at the time of purchase. The subsequent payments are due every two weeks. Afterpay sends reminders via email and push notifications to help customers stay on track. While Afterpay itself doesn't charge interest, late payments can incur fees, so it's essential to maintain a clear understanding of the payment schedule and ensure sufficient funds are available in your linked account.

Michael Kors Afterpay Return Policy: Navigating Returns with Afterpay

One of the most important aspects to consider when using Afterpay is the return policy. Michael Kors' return policy, when used in conjunction with Afterpay, requires careful attention. Generally, Michael Kors offers a return window, typically within a specific timeframe (e.g., 30 days) from the date of purchase. However, the process is slightly more involved when Afterpay is involved.

When returning an item purchased with Afterpay, you'll need to initiate the return process with Michael Kors in the same way you would for a standard purchase. This usually involves presenting your receipt and the item in its original condition with all tags attached. The store associate will then process the return.

Michael Kors Returns: The Process Explained

The return process at Michael Kors stores is designed to be efficient and straightforward. However, the presence of Afterpay adds a layer of complexity. Once the return is processed by the store, the refund will be credited back to your original payment method. However, this doesn't immediately mean the Afterpay payments are cancelled.

With Afterpay, the refund will be processed as a credit to your Afterpay account. This credit will then be applied to your outstanding payments. If the refund is equal to or greater than the remaining balance, your payments will be cancelled, and you'll receive a notification. If the refund is less than the remaining balance, the remaining payments will still be due according to the original schedule, but the amount due will be reduced by the refund amount.
